PyTorch与TensorFlow有什么区别

PyTorch和TensorFlow是两个广泛使用的深度学习框架,它们有一些区别,包括以下几点:动态图 vs 静态图:PyTorch使用动态图,这意味着在构建计算图时可以即时进行调试和修改。而TensorFlow使用静态图,需要先定义计算图,然后再执行。动态图可以更容易地进行调试和实验,但静态图在一些情况下可能更高效。API设计:PyTorch的API设计更符合Pythonic风格,更容易上手和

PyTorch和TensorFlow是两个广泛使用的深度学习框架,它们有一些区别,包括以下几点:

  1. 动态图 vs 静态图:PyTorch使用动态图,这意味着在构建计算图时可以即时进行调试和修改。而TensorFlow使用静态图,需要先定义计算图,然后再执行。动态图可以更容易地进行调试和实验,但静态图在一些情况下可能更高效。

  2. API设计:PyTorch的API设计更符合Pythonic风格,更容易上手和使用。TensorFlow的API设计更加模块化和复杂,有一定的学习曲线。

  3. 社区支持:TensorFlow是由Google开发并维护,有着庞大的社区支持和资源。PyTorch是由Facebook开发,并且在学术界和研究领域中更受欢迎。

  4. 部署:TensorFlow在生产环境中有更好的部署支持和性能优化。PyTorch在研究和实验阶段更受欢迎。

总的来说,选择PyTorch还是TensorFlow取决于个人偏好、项目需求以及开发团队的经验和技术栈。两者都是强大的深度学习框架,都可以用于构建高效的机器学习模型。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至 55@qq.com 举报,一经查实,本站将立刻删除。转转请注明出处:https://www.szhjjp.com/n/915375.html

(0)
派派
上一篇 2024-03-06
下一篇 2024-03-06

相关推荐

  • linux如何备份db2数据库

    在Linux系统中备份DB2数据库可以使用DB2提供的工具db2backup或者使用操作系统的备份工具。以下是使用db2backup进行备份的步骤:登录到Linux系统上的DB2实例。执行以下命令来备份数据库:db2backup -d -t -f 其中,是要备份的数据库名称,是备份的类型(如在线备份或离线备份),

    2024-04-12
    0
  • Linux中怎么备份和还原文件或目录

    在Linux系统中,可以使用以下命令来备份和还原文件或目录:备份文件或目录:# 备份单个文件cp source_file destination_file# 备份整个目录cp -r source_directory destination_directory还原文件或目录:# 还原单个文件cp backup_file original_file# 还原整个目录cp -r backup_di

    2024-04-30
    0
  • 「什么样的域名好听好记」好用的域名

    什么样的域名好听好记,好用的域名 内容导航: 怎样取一个比较好听的域名 什么样域名才算好简短好记我知道还有什么可以考虑的方面吗 大家帮我看看这个域名 改域名 一、怎样取一个比较好听…

    2022-08-07
    0
  • excel复利计算函数(Excel做复利终值系数表)

    贷款利息贷款50万元,年利率6.75%,期限5年,每月等额本息还款,每月要还多少?公式“=pmt(6.75%/12,60,500000)”=-9841.73元,直接复制双引号里公式到Excel表格,简单修改下数据。按确定就可以显示实际值(后面公

    2021-08-21 技术经验
    0
  • shell中while使用要注意哪些事项

    在使用shell中的while循环时,需要注意以下几个事项:循环条件:while循环的条件必须是一个能够返回真或假的表达式。通常使用比较运算符(如==、!=、-gt、-lt等)来判断条件是否成立。循环体:在while循环中,需要在循环体内编写要执行的命令或语句。可以是单个命令,也可以是一系列命令。循环体的开头和结尾需要使用do和done关键字进行标记。条件更新:在循环体内部需要更新循环条件,否则可

    2024-02-05
    0
  • 如何在Oracle数据库中创建用户并分配权限

    要在Oracle数据库中创建用户并分配权限,可以按照以下步骤进行操作:使用sys用户登录到Oracle数据库。执行以下SQL语句创建新用户:CREATE USER new_user IDENTIFIED BY password;其中,new_user是要创建的用户名,password是用户的密码。授予新用户所需的权限。例如,如果要授予新用户对某个表的SELECT权限,可以执行以下SQL语句:GRA

    2024-03-03
    0

发表回复

登录后才能评论